This is an example of causal reasoning.
Explanation:
It is an example of causal reasoning because the statement is relating two facts as if one would be the cause of the other. In this case, being bald is the cause, and the effect is a heart attack. The flaw in this reasoning is that there is not enough evidence to prove that baldness can increase the risk of heart attacks. That is something that science has to investigate to check that this statement is not a fallacy of false cause.

The methods you can use to treat a bruise includes:
- Rest the bruised area, if possible.
- Ice the bruise with an ice pack wrapped in a towel regularly
- Compress the bruised area if it is swelling, using an elastic bandage.
<h3>Meaning of Bruise</h3>
A bruise can be defined as an injury that occurs in a part of the body due to an event where the blood vessel are affected by a heavy fall or hit, causing a release of blood that gets trapped under the skin, forming a red or purplish mark that is tender when you touched.
